Method
Chips
- 1
Prepare the Tortillas
Cut the corn tortillas into triangles to create chip shapes.
- 2
Heat the Oil
In a large frying pan,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at until it shimmers.
- 3
Fry the Chips
Carefully add a handful of tortilla triangles to the hot oil. Fry them for about 2-3 minutes or until they turn golden brown and crispy. Remove them with a slotted spoon.
- 4
Drain and Season
Place the fried chips on paper towels to drain excess oil. Sprinkle with salt while they are still hot.
Salsa
- 5
- 6
Combine Ingredients
In a medium mixing bowl, combine the diced tomatoes, onion, jalapeño pepper, and cilantro.
- 7
Add Lime and Salt
Pour lime juice over the mixture and sprinkle with salt. Stir until well mixed.
- 8
Adjust Seasoning
Taste the salsa and adjust the seasoning with more salt or lime juice if needed.
